SINGAPORE, 15 September 2026: Explora Journeys introduces two new Journey Collections for the traditional Northern Winter 2027-2028 season, offering South America aboard EXPLORA I and the Mediterranean and Atlantic Islands aboard EXPLORA V.
These new Journey Collections join the previously announced programme, complementing EXPLORA II and EXPLORA IV in the Caribbean and EXPLORA III in Asia.

EXPLORA I
From December 2027 to March 2028, EXPLORA I takes full advantage of the Southern Hemisphere summer, charting a course through the contrasting landscapes and natural wonders of Brazil, Uruguay, Argentina, the Falkland Islands and Chile.
Guests will experience tropical shores, golden coastlines and festive celebrations, including Christmas at sea and New Year’s Eve on the Brazilian seafront.
Five overnight stays in ports such as Buenos Aires, Puerto Madryn and Rio de Janeiro promise lingering evenings, complemented by eight late departures in coastal cities ranging from Balneário Camboriú and Port Stanley to Rio and Maceiจฎ. Unveiling 20 maiden destinations along the way, including 12 in Brazil, the ship will move from lively cultural hubs into the raw, untamed majesty of the far south.
Sweeping towards Patagonia, the itinerary connects Montevideo and the wildlife-rich waters of the Beagle Channel with Puerto Williams, Punta Arenas and the legendary shores of Cape Horn. The route passes glaciers, fjords and isolated archipelagos, delivering pristine wilderness alongside refined oceanfront living.
